- Andrographis shows antitumor effects in esophageal squamous cell carcinoma (ESCC).
- It enhances the efficacy of 5-fluorouracil (5-FU) by altering ferroptosis-related genes.
- In vitro experiments demonstrated inhibition of cell proliferation and colony formation.
- Andrographis induces apoptosis and upregulates ferroptosis-related genes like HMOX1, GCLC, and GCLM.
- Combination with 5-FU at sub-IC50 doses results in additive antitumor effects.
- Potential as adjunctive therapy to improve efficacy and reduce 5-FU dosage and toxicity.
